This journal focuses on advancements in energy conversion and storage technologies. Research areas include the development of efficient solar cells, such as perovskite and silicon-based photovoltaics, and improvements in battery technologies, including zinc-ion and sodium-ion batteries. The scope also encompasses materials science for energy applications, such as transparent conductive oxides, quantum dots, and organic electrode materials, as well as photocatalysis for hydrogen production and photon management strategies like triplet-triplet annihilation upconversion.
